Apple releases new iOS app with one function: Watch iAds

Apple released today a new iOS app called “iAd Gallery”. The app allows users to watch iAds outside of third-party apps.

Apple releases new iAd developing tool

Apple released today a new tool to help create iAds. “iAd Producer” allows users to create iAds with an easy to use user interface.

Renault Twizy will be the first European iAd, launching tomorrow

Renault will launch Europe’s first iAd on Thursday, December 2 with a campaign for Renault Twizy, its new 100% electric tandem-style city car.

Adidas backs out of a $10 million iAd deal due to Apple’s control of the process

According to Business Insider, Adidas decided to pull out from a $10 million iAd deal due to Apple’s heavy control of the process.
